0910
Cardiff Central
Departed on time
Great Western Railway · 9 coaches
4
0911
London Paddington
Departed at 0914
Great Western Railway · 9 coaches
3
0920
London Paddington
Departed at 0925
Great Western Railway · 9 coaches
1
0922
Weston-super-Mare
Departed at 0925
Great Western Railway · 9 coaches
4
0929
Cheltenham Spa
Departed at 0931
Great Western Railway · 5 coaches
3
0940
London Paddington
Departed at 0945
Great Western Railway · 9 coaches
3
0941
Swansea
Departed on time
Great Western Railway · 5 coaches
4
0945
London Paddington
Departed at 0951
Great Western Railway · 9 coaches
1
0958
Bristol Temple Meads
Departed at 0959
Great Western Railway · 9 coaches
4
0958
London Paddington
Departed on time
Great Western Railway · 5 coaches
1
1010
London Paddington
Departed at 1011
Great Western Railway · 9 coaches
3
1014
Cardiff Central
Departed on time
Great Western Railway · 8 coaches
4
1022
Bristol Temple Meads
Departed on time
Great Western Railway · 9 coaches
4
1022
London Paddington
Departed on time
Great Western Railway · 10 coaches
1
1030
Cheltenham Spa
Departed on time
Great Western Railway · 5 coaches
3
1040
London Paddington
Departed at 1047
Great Western Railway · 9 coaches
3
1042
Carmarthen
Departed on time
Great Western Railway · 10 coaches
4
1048
London Paddington
Departed at 1052
Great Western Railway · 8 coaches
3
1056
Bristol Temple Meads
Departed on time
Great Western Railway · 5 coaches
4
1100
Reading
Departed at 1146
Great Western Railway · 5 coaches
1